The Scorpio Races

The Scorpio Races by Maggie Stiefvater is a captivating tale published by Scholastic in 2017, featuring 496 pages in English. Set against the backdrop of the annual Scorpio Races, the story follows Sean Kendrick, the only man on the island skilled enough to tame the fierce water horses, and Puck, who enters the competition to save her family despite riding an ordinary mare. As they both strive to change their lives, the narrative explores the challenges they face in this dangerous and thrilling event.
Readers will find a rich blend of action and adventure intertwined with themes of family and love. The story delves into the intense rivalry of the races and the bond between humans and animals, highlighting the stakes involved in both the competition and personal aspirations. With elements of fantasy and magic woven throughout, this edition invites readers to immerse themselves in a world where survival is paramount and the quest for change drives the characters forward.
Official synopsis Publisher
Every November, the Scorpio Races are run beneath the chalk cliffs of Skarmouth. Sean Kendrick is the only man on the island capable of taming the beasts. Puck enters the races to save her family, but he horse she rides is an ordinary little mare. They both enter the Races hoping to change their lives. But first they’ll have to survive.
